Annette Kinder is a scholar working on Cognitive Neuroscience, Artificial Intelligence and Social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Annette Kinder has authored 27 papers receiving a total of 554 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 16 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 12 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 7 papers in Social Psychology. Recurrent topics in Annette Kinder’s work include Speech and dialogue systems (9 papers), Natural Language Processing Techniques (7 papers) and Topic Modeling (5 papers). Annette Kinder is often cited by papers focused on Speech and dialogue systems (9 papers), Natural Language Processing Techniques (7 papers) and Topic Modeling (5 papers). Annette Kinder coll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United Kingdom and Hungary. Annette Kinder's co-authors include Harald Lachnit, Arthur M. Jacobs, David R. Shanks, Sascha Tamm and Martin Rolfs and has published in prestigious journals such as Psychological Review, Journal of Cognitive Neuroscience and Journal of Experimental Psychology Human Perception & Performance.
